Output eda1326cdf3daa332e95ea14181c361fef9bc8f28869d9902a7cb217c96f6115:1

value
20960
script pubkey
OP_0 OP_PUSHBYTES_20 8ec7b3479bed1588c997f1a2c7ca096494a77f33
address
bc1q3mrmx3uma52c3jvh7x3v0jsfvj22wlen9pcz5f
transaction
eda1326cdf3daa332e95ea14181c361fef9bc8f28869d9902a7cb217c96f6115
confirmations
286576
spent
true